Biography:
At present I am engaged on a source book on Roman warfare to serve
as a companion to a Greek one published in 1996. It will contain introductory
general essays, essays on specific topics as well as translations
of relevant passages. The period covered will be from the regal period
to the end of the fourth century. At present I am working on the second
chapter which deals with the origins and development of thew manipular
army. Command structure, logistics, social factors, equipment and
descriptions of various types of battles. The sources used are of
all types including literary sources, archaeological material, coins
and inscriptions.
